### Firmware channel recovery — Fernwick devices

If the Updraft channel stops serving manifests, restart the publisher pod, then re-promote the last known-good build. Verify checksum before promoting. Do not roll devices back remotely. Publisher calls authenticate against the internal Relaygate service; use the key below.

gateway credential: kto23_LX9A4ys6i4nzHtpOLNLodKK

## Checkout Load Testing — Staging Environment

The Veltrix checkout flow is load tested exclusively in the staging tier, which mirrors production topology but uses synthetic payment stubs. Traffic generators run from an isolated subnet, and all test credentials rotate after each run. Reviewers should verify rate limits match production before approving. The staging configuration used for these runs is as follows.

config for kafof-bawef:
holath:
  log_level: debug
  metrics_host: metrics.holath.qorvelsys.internal
  pin: 2191
  pool_size: 32

# Lanternfell Reports — Environments

Hey, welcome aboard! Quick heads-up on the thing that bites every new contractor: timezone handling in report exports. The service stores everything in UTC, but each environment renders exports in a configured display zone — dev uses UTC, staging uses the Harrowgate office zone, and prod follows the customer's tenant setting. If an export looks "off by a few hours," check the environment before filing anything. To save you the spelunking, staging currently runs with the configuration values below.

deployment values, yafop-tahof:
HOLIX_HOST=holix.zemvarsys.internal
HOLIX_PORT=3306

Action item (Lockstep matching outage, follow-up 3): GC pauses on the Lockstep matcher exceeded 900ms during peak, stalling match assignment and triggering duplicate retries downstream. Short term, heap has been capped and the pause alert threshold lowered to 400ms. Owner: runtime team; due end of sprint. On-call should treat repeated pause alerts as a restart-and-escalate situation, not a wait-and-see one. Tuning parameters, heap dump procedure, and escalation path are documented here.

runbook for fadug-kawep: https://jira.lumicdata.internal/job